MOTS-c (Mitochondrial Open Reading Frame of the Twelve S rRNA type-c) is a mitochondrial-derived peptide (MDP) encoded within the 12S rRNA gene of mitochondrial DNA. This 16-amino acid peptide represents a novel class of signaling molecules that originate from the mitochondrial genome, establishing a retrograde signaling pathway from mitochondria to the nucleus. MOTS-c has been shown to regulate metabolic homeostasis by activating AMPK signaling, enhancing glucose uptake, and modulating the folate-methionine cycle. Research has demonstrated its role in improving insulin sensitivity, promoting fatty acid oxidation, and protecting against metabolic stress. The peptide has also been studied for its exercise-mimetic properties and its potential involvement in the beneficial effects of physical activity on metabolic health. MOTS-c levels have been found to decline with age, suggesting a role in age-related metabolic changes. Supplied as a lyophilized powder. For research use only.
